  • what is minority influence
    the influence of one person or a small group on the beliefs and behaviours of others
    minority influence leads to internalisation

  • what are the 6 ao1 points for moscovici's experiment
    -the first group had two confederates who consistently said the slides were green.
    -the true participants gave the same wrong answer (green) on 8.42% of the trials.
    -second group of participants were exposed to an inconsistent minority (the confederates said 'green' 24 times an 'blue' 12 times)
    -in this case, agreement with the answer 'green' fell to 1.25%
    -third control group were were no confederates and all participants had to do was identify the colour of each slide
    -they got this wrong on just 0.25% of the trials.
  • define consistency
    synchronic consistency - all member of the minority are saying the same thing
    diachronic consistency- all members of the minority have been saying the same thing for a while.
    makes the majority rethink their views.
  • define commitment
    helps the minority group to gain attention
    members of the minority take part in activities that cause some risk to themselves to demonstrate their commitment to the cause.
    augmentation principle - the majority may even more attention.
  • define flexibility
    the minority should consider the other points of view to avoid appearing rigid.
    they should adapt their point of view and accept reasonable counter arguments.
  • describe the process of social change
    when we hear something new we consider it, especially if it is consistent, committed and flexible.
    this deeper processing is important in the conversion to a minority viewpoint.
    overtime, people switch from the majority to the minority. they have converted.
    the more this happens, the faster the rate of conversion. this is called the snowball effect. the minority view becomes the majority view and change has occurred.
